ADJUSTMENT
Note. On vehicles with electronic chassis controls, ensure all systems are functional before adjusting riding height or wheel alignment.
Before adjusting alignment, check riding height. Riding height must be checked with vehicle on level floor and tires properly inflated. Tire inflation specifications can be found on door pillar, side wall of tire, sun visor or glove box. Bounce vehicle several times and allow suspension to settle.
Visually inspect vehicle for signs of abnormal height from front to rear or side to side. Remove extra heavy items from passenger and luggage compartments. If riding height is not within specifications, check, repair or replace suspension components. See RIDING HEIGHT SPECIFICATIONS table. (Scheme 2)

FWD VEHICLES
When supporting vehicle with floor jack, place support at suspension lift points or frame lift points. Floor jacks may be placed under front crossmember on most models. (Scheme 3)- (Scheme 8).
RWD VEHICLES
Floor jack may be used under rear axle or front suspension lower control arms. Observe the following precautions
- NEVER use jack on any part of underbody.
- DO NOT raise entire vehicle at side rail with jack midway between front and rear wheels, or permanent body damage may result.
- DO NOT allow lifting plate fingers to contact axle cover plate when lifting at rear axle housing.
- If vehicle is equipped with a stabilizer bar, DO NOT lift at rear axle housing. (Scheme 3)- (Scheme 8).
BUMPER JACK
Bumper jack should only be used if supplied as original equipment with vehicle. If vehicle is not supplied with a bumper jack, DO NOT lift vehicle by the bumper at any time. Bumper jack should only be used to change flat tire.
Note. Always follow hoist manufacturer's instructions. DO NOT allow hoist or adapters to contact suspension, exhaust or steering components. Frame contact must be made. Use adapters if necessary. Lift vehicle as shown in illustrations. Illustration is not available for Corvette.
AXLE CONTACT HOIST
Hoist should contact lower control arms or front crossmember, and rear axle as shown in illustrations. (Scheme 3)- (Scheme 8).
FRAME CONTACT HOIST
Hoist adapters must contact vehicle in specified areas. (Scheme 3)- (Scheme 8). Adapters must be positioned to distribute load and support vehicle in a stable manner. DO NOT allow lift pads to contact exhaust system components. On Corvette, position frame contact hoist on frame rails, forward of rear wheels and rearward of front wheels.
| CAUTION | If removing rear axle, fuel tank, spare tire or liftgate, and single-post hoist is used, anchor vehicle to hoist. Place jack stands under vehicle or add weight on rear end of vehicle to prevent tipping when center of gravity changes. |

ADJUSTMENTS
Note. Refer to RIDING HEIGHT SPECIFICATIONS table for body code applications.
CAMBER ADJUSTMENT: A, J, L & N BODIES
To adjust front camber, loosen 2 strut-to-steering knuckle bolts. (Scheme 9) Move top of wheel in or out to obtain correct camber specification. While holding wheel in position, tighten 2 strut-to-steering knuckle bolts. Rear camber is not adjustable. If rear camber is not to specification, repair or replace damaged or worn suspension or body parts.

CAMBER ADJUSTMENT: B, D & Y BODIES
Adjust front camber by adding or subtracting equal number of shims between both ends of upper control arm shaft and frame. (Scheme 10) To adjust rear camber on Corvette, loosen lower spindle rod adjusting cam lock nut and bolt. Turn cam to obtain correct camber. (Scheme 11) Tighten adjusting cam lock nut and bolt.

CAMBER ADJUSTMENT: C & H BODIES
To adjust front or rear camber, loosen 2 strut-to-steering knuckle bolts. Install Camber Adjuster (J-29862). (Scheme 12) Tighten or loosen camber adjuster as necessary to obtain correct camber. While holding wheel in position, tighten 2 strut-to-steering knuckle bolts.

CAMBER ADJUSTMENT: E & K BODIES
To adjust camber, loosen 2 strut-to-steering knuckle bolts. Tighten or loosen camber adjusting bolt, located above spindle next to upper strut-to-steering knuckle bolt, to obtain correct camber. While holding wheel in position, tighten 2 strut-to-steering knuckle bolts.
CAMBER ADJUSTMENT: F BODY
To adjust camber and caster, remove dust cap from upper strut tower. Using a fender bolt, attach Adjuster (J-29724) to fender. (Scheme 13) Loosen 3 strut mount-to-strut tower nuts. Adjust camber and caster to specification. Tighten nuts to 21 ft. lbs. (28 N.m). Remove adjuster.

CAMBER ADJUSTMENT: W BODY
- To adjust front camber, loosen 3 strut cover attaching nuts. Remove strut cover. Lift front of vehicle enough to allow strut attaching studs to clear mounting holes. Cover top of strut to keep metal shavings from damaging strut. Using Template (J-36892) as a guide, file the 3 holes as necessary to allow for camber adjustment. (Scheme 14) CAUTION: DO NOT lift vehicle by suspension components, or over extend the drive axles when lifting vehicle.
- Paint exposed surfaces with Red oxide primer. Paint area to match color of vehicle. Lower front of vehicle while aligning studs into holes. Install, but DO NOT tighten 3 strut cover attaching nuts. Set camber to specification. Tighten strut cover attaching nuts to 17 ft. lbs. (24 N.m).
- To adjust rear camber, raise vehicle and remove rear wheel. Using Spring Compressor (J-35778), remove rear leaf spring. Remove strut assembly. Place strut assembly in vise. File lower strut-to-spindle mounting hole, lower strut attaching hole and lower stabilizer bracket-to-strut attaching hole to allow for camber adjustment. (Scheme 15) Install strut assembly. Adjust camber to specification. Tighten rear strut-to-spindle nuts to 136 ft. lbs. (184 N.m).

CASTER ADJUSTMENT: A, J, L, N & W BODIES
Caster is not adjustable. If caster is not to specification, check for worn or damaged suspension or body parts. Repair or replace as necessary.
CASTER ADJUSTMENT: B, D & Y BODIES
Caster is adjusted by transferring shims, from front to rear or rear to front, of the upper control arm shaft mounts and frame. (Scheme 10) The difference between left and right caster should NOT be more than 1/2 degree.
CASTER ADJUSTMENT: C, E, H & K BODIES
- Loosen, but DO NOT remove, one front outer nut and one inner nut from strut mounting tower. (Scheme 16) Remove remaining nut and washer from strut mounting tower. Raise vehicle until outer strut stud has cleared hole.
- Using an 11/32" drill bit, drill one hole in front and one behind outer strut hole. File excess material from between holes to create an elongated slot. Lower vehicle to install strut into tower. Adjust caster to specification. Tighten nuts to 17 ft. lbs. (24 N.m).
CASTER ADJUSTMENT: F BODY
To adjust caster, see F BODY under CAMBER ADJUSTMENT: F BODY .

FRONT TOE-IN ADJUSTMENT: A,C, E, H, K, N, W & Y BODIES
Loosen tie rod end lock nut. (Scheme 17) Loosen steering gear dust boot clamp(s) at tie rod end. Turn tie rod end to obtain correct toe-in. Tighten lock nut to specification. See TORQUE SPECIFICATIONS. Ensure steering gear dust boot is straight after adjustment. Tighten dust boot clamp.

FRONT TOE-IN ADJUSTMENT: B, D, F, J & L BODIES
Loosen tie rod end adjusting sleeve clamp bolts. Turn center adjusting sleeve to adjust toe-in. (Scheme 18) Ensure bolts are at bottom of tie rod and facing forward. Tighten tie rod end adjusting sleeve clamp bolts.

TOE-IN ADJUSTMENT (REAR): A & N BODIES
Rear toe-in is not adjustable. If rear toe-in is not to specification, repair or replace worn or damaged components.
TOE-IN ADJUSTMENT (REAR): E & K BODIES
Loosen front and rear inside control arm mounting bolts. Pry between rear control arm mounting bolts and rear support assembly until proper toe-in is obtained. (Scheme 19) Tighten control arm mounting bolts to 66 ft. lbs. (90 N.m).

TOE-IN ADJUSTMENT (REAR): Y BODY
Loosen rear tie rod adjusting lock nut. Turn tie rod end to obtain correct toe-in. Tighten lock nut to specification. See TORQUE SPECIFICATIONS .
TOE-IN ADJUSTMENT (REAR): W BODY
- Using holes in rear suspension rod and jack stand pad, hook Turnbuckle Adjuster (J-38118) between rear suspension rod and jack stand pad. Hand tighten turnbuckle adjuster.
- Loosen rear rod-to-crossmember nut at crossmember a minimum of 4 turns. Tighten or loosen turnbuckle adjuster as necessary to obtain correct rear toe-in. Tighten rear rod-to-crossmember nut to 81 ft. lbs. (110 N.m), plus an additional 1/6 turn (60 degrees).
